For what it's worth, there is not an abundance of face value tickets anywhere, that people are keeping from you in some kind of effort to force your hand into paying more for tickets. Pickings are slim. At present, there are approximately 15 tickets being offered (plus a couple more ticket deals in 'pending' state). We've had more than 3,000 new members to ePlaya since the start of the busy season (July/August), with more than 2,000 of them having arrived just since tickets sold out on July 24th. Your best bet is to read the announcements and focus your efforts on the threads with tickets offered. Good luck.
